package com.googlecode.objectify.test;

import com.google.appengine.api.datastore.DatastoreServiceFactory;
import com.google.appengine.api.datastore.Entity;
import com.google.appengine.api.datastore.Key;
import com.google.appengine.api.datastore.KeyFactory;
import com.googlecode.objectify.cache.CachingAsyncDatastoreService;
import com.googlecode.objectify.cache.EntityMemcache;
import com.googlecode.objectify.test.util.MockAsyncDatastoreService;
import com.googlecode.objectify.test.util.TestBase;
import org.testng.annotations.BeforeMethod;
import org.testng.annotations.Test;
import java.util.Collections;
import java.util.List;
import java.util.Map;
import java.util.Set;
import java.util.concurrent.Future;
import java.util.logging.Logger;

/**
* Tests of the caching datastore directly, outside of the rest of Objectify. Tries to create as few
* future wrappers as possible so we can easily see what is going on.
*
* @author Jeff Schnitzer <jeff@infohazard.org>
*/
public class CachingDatastoreTests extends TestBase
{
  /** */
  @SuppressWarnings("unused")
  private static Logger log = Logger.getLogger(CachingDatastoreTests.class.getName());
 
  /** Caching */
  CachingAsyncDatastoreService cads;
 
  /** No datastore */
  CachingAsyncDatastoreService nods;

  /** Simple bits of data to use */
  Key key;
  Set<Key> keyInSet;
  Entity entity;
  List<Entity> entityInList;
 
  /**
   */
  @BeforeMethod
  public void setUpExtra()
  {
    EntityMemcache mc = new EntityMemcache(null);
    cads = new CachingAsyncDatastoreService(DatastoreServiceFactory.getAsyncDatastoreService(), mc);
    nods = new CachingAsyncDatastoreService(new MockAsyncDatastoreService(), mc);
   
    key = KeyFactory.createKey("thing", 1);
    keyInSet = Collections.singleton(key);
    entity = new Entity(key);
    entity.setProperty("foo", "bar");
    entityInList = Collections.singletonList(entity);
  }
 
  /** */
  @Test
  public void testNegativeCache() throws Exception
  {
    Future<Map<Key, Entity>> fent = cads.get(null, keyInSet);
    assert fent.get().isEmpty();
   
    // Now that it's called, make sure we have a negative cache entry
    Future<Map<Key, Entity>> cached = nods.get(null, keyInSet);
    assert cached.get().isEmpty();
  }

  /** */
  @Test
  public void testBasicCache() throws Exception
  {
    Future<List<Key>> fkey = cads.put(null, entityInList);
    List<Key> putResult = fkey.get();
   
    Future<Map<Key, Entity>> fent = cads.get(null, putResult);
    assert fent.get().values().iterator().next().getProperty("foo").equals("bar");
   
    // Now make sure it is in the cache
    Future<Map<Key, Entity>> cached = nods.get(null, putResult);
    assert cached.get().values().iterator().next().getProperty("foo").equals("bar");
  }
}
